你查询的IP:[119.128.143.3]  地理位置:中国–广东–东莞

最新查询114.64.252.226 117.124.74.148 202.130.205.8 123.96.216.247 123.96.95.80 123.137.108.3 121.201.131.158 125.104.124.107 125.112.140.212 119.128.143.3 203.100.96.22 124.6.64.49 203.81.16.183 123.199.128.44 218.56.196.240 120.136.128.254 120.137.242.6 218.104.93.142 119.18.192.233 202.93.24.196 119.75.208.4 58.192.232.129 202.127.48.10 218.192.253.124 203.92.160.232 119.3.25.81 119.40.64.145 122.102.204.63 124.249.219.216 202.8.128.79 222.176.73.238